According to recent reports, a hero of the 2018 FIFA World Cup is considering a transfer to Olympique de Marseille. The player, whose identity has not been officially confirmed, could provide a significant boost to the club's performance and market value.

Olympique de Marseille, owned by American businessman Frank McCourt, has been active in the transfer market. McCourt, who purchased the club in 2016, has invested heavily in recent years to improve the team's competitiveness in Ligue 1 and European competitions.

The potential arrival of a World Cup winner would align with Marseille's ambitions to challenge for top honors. The club finished third in Ligue 1 last season and is looking to strengthen its squad for the upcoming campaign.

While no official announcement has been made, the speculation has generated excitement among Marseille supporters. The transfer window remains open until the end of August, leaving time for negotiations to progress.
